Please follow these instructions to subscribe to the calendar in Outlook on Windows:
- Copy the calendar link.
- Switch to the calendar view in Outlook.
- Right click My calendars (or Other calendars), select Add calendar, select From Internet.
- In the dialogue that pops up, paste the calendar link.
- Approve the subscription.
The calendar is now available in Outlook. Check the checkbox besides the new calendar to view it.

Half-time seminar: Influence of intra- and extracellular free drug concentrations in the human colon on local and systemic drug exposure
Rebekkah Hammar, Phd Student at the Department of Pharmacy and SweDeliver, presents her work to determine drug distribution in human colonoids and microbiota models to create a PBPK model of the colonic environment. Thus, enabling better estimation of colonic drug efficacy and to reduce the need for animal models.
